Job description
Our client, a leading organisation in the defence and security sector, is currently seeking a Network Engineer - Juniper to join their team in Portsmouth. This permanent role offers a unique opportunity to work with cutting-edge technology and play a key role in the delivery of key communications and network systems., * Investigate and resolve technical issues across existing networks and systems
- Support multiple projects and ensure timely delivery of technical outputs
- Implement and configure new systems and solutions
- Collaborate with project managers and technical leads to deliver quality outputs
- Assist with system implementations and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ives
- Develop processes and support the team by sharing knowledge and providing practical solutions
- Maintain high standards of professionalism in a structured IT environment
Requirements
- Hands-on experience in networking, IT, and communications
- Prior experience as a network engineer within an IT department
- Experience in supporting Juniper SRX-based networks, including cyber patches and issue investigations
- Understanding of Microsoft, Windows, Linux, or coding environments is advantageous
- Ability to investigate problems and provide solutions to complex network issues
- Degree in engineering or equivalent IT-related experience
